The Minnesota Vikings selected Ohio State guard Donovan Jackson as the 24th pick in the NFL draft, completing an offensive line overhaul. Jackson, a second-team All-American, will join newly signed center Ryan Kelly and right guard Will Fries. The team released center Garrett Bradbury and may have three new starters in the middle. They have three picks left in the draft.
